In today’s business environment organisations are under increasing pressure to ensure their workforce is fully certified to carry out their duties. Regulatory compliance, increasing litigation and the growing complexity of product portfolios are driving the need for continuous learning and knowledge transfer programmes to the top of the agenda.
Using traditional methods, the costs involved in transferring key knowledge from those who know to those who need to know can be exorbitant, particularly in large organisations. Ever changing products, policies and procedures add to the complexity of managing workforce certification, necessitating a state of continuous learning – a state which until recently was not even realisable.
